The ideal potting mix composition for orchids depends entirely on which genus you’re growing, because root structure dictates moisture needs. Phalaenopsis (moth orchids) need a bark-heavy blend that follows a 3–5 day wet-dry cycle, while terrestrial orchids like Paphiopedilum and Phragmipedium require mixes that stay damp without suffocating the roots. Getting the ratio wrong — using a one-size-fits-all bag or skipping amendments — is the fastest route to root rot, stalled growth, or a plant that refuses to bloom.

Why Potting Mix Composition Determines Orchid Health

Orchids break into two root categories, and each demands a different mix strategy. Epiphytic orchids (Phalaenopsis, Cattleya, Dendrobium) grow on tree bark in the wild. Their thick, air-loving roots need large bark particles and fast drainage so air circulates freely between watering cycles. Terrestrial orchids (Paphiopedilum, Phragmipedium) grow in soil-like debris on the forest floor. Their thinner roots require consistent moisture with enough perlite or pumice to keep the medium from compacting into mud.

Using a terrestrial mix on an epiphytic orchid holds too much water and rots the roots. Using an epiphytic mix on a terrestrial orchid dries out too fast and stresses the plant. The genus-first approach eliminates both problems.

Potting Mix Composition for Every Orchid Type: Recipes That Work

Each genus has a proven recipe that balances aeration, moisture retention, and decomposition rate. The ratios below come from working growers and the American Orchid Society, and they’re specific enough to mix by volume in a bucket.

Phalaenopsis (Moth Orchid) Recipes

The most common household orchid, Phalaenopsis needs a mix that dries noticeably between waterings. Four recipes cover the range from cool-spiking to miniature pots:

  • Cool-Spiking Recipe (moist, airy, slight dry cycle): 65% Pine Bark, 15% Sphagnum Moss, 10% Pumice/Perlite, 10% Charcoal.
  • Summer-Blooming Recipe (evenly moist, approaching dryness between waterings): 50% Pine Bark, 25% Sphagnum Moss, 15% Pumice/Perlite, 10% Charcoal, plus ½ cup peatmoss per 4 liters.
  • Standard Commercial Mix (3–4 inch pots): 50% Bark + 50% Fir Bark, medium grade.
  • Miniature Phals (2-inch pots): 100% Premium Sphagnum Moss, long-fibered and debris-free. The small pot size makes pure moss work because it dries fast enough.

Terrestrial Orchid Recipes

Terrestrial orchids need the opposite approach — always moist, always ventilated, never soggy. Three recipes cover the main genera:

  • Phragmipedium (always wet, ventilated): 50% Pumice, 25% Pine/Fir Bark, 15% Charcoal, 10% Sphagnum Moss. The pot can sit in ¼ inch of water when temperatures stay above 16°C.
  • Mud Mix (for jewel orchids and summer Phals, always moist): 50% Peatmoss, 40% Pumice/Perlite, 10% Charcoal.
  • Paphiopedilum (always moist, ventilated): 60% Pine Bark, 20% Pumice/Perlite, 10% Charcoal, 10% Sphagnum Moss, plus ½ cup peatmoss per 4 liters.

What Particle Size Does Your Orchid Need?

Particle size controls how much air reaches the roots, and the wrong size is as damaging as the wrong ingredient. The Eric Young Orchid Foundation standard uses three grades that match the plant’s maturity and root thickness:

  • Seedlings (thin roots): ¼-inch diameter particles — “seedling grade.” Small particles hold more moisture around tiny root systems.
  • Medium Plants (the most common size): ½-inch diameter — “medium grade.” This fits the root thickness of most Phalaenopsis and Cattleyas in 3–6 inch pots.
  • Large Orchids (mature Cattleyas, large Dendrobiums): ¾-inch diameter — “coarse grade.” Thick roots need big air pockets between particles.

Mixing particle sizes within a single pot is fine as long as the dominant size matches the root thickness. A blend of ½-inch and ¼-inch bark works well for a plant that’s transitioning from seedling to medium.

Should You Buy or DIY Your Orchid Mix?

Commercial mixes save time and come pre-balanced with the right amendments, but they cost more per pot than bulk DIY ingredients. DIY gives you full control over particle size and moisture retention, and a single batch of bark, perlite, and charcoal covers every orchid you own. A good compromise: buy a premium mix for your most valuable plants and mix your own for the rest. How to Prepare Your Mix for Potting

Dry mix repels water — roots stay thirsty even after you water. The pre-soak step is the non-negotiable fix that experienced growers never skip. Soak your mix for 24 hours, then let it drain fully before potting. Stir the batch thoroughly right before use, because ingredients settle differently during storage. When you remove the old media from the roots, clear away any dark or mushy pieces before placing the orchid in fresh mix. If the mix dries too fast after potting, add more sphagnum moss next time. If it stays wet too long, increase the perlite or bark proportion.

Bark decays faster than charcoal or perlite. Replace the entire mix every 12 months — the American Orchid Society’s media guidance notes that old compacted bark chokes roots and holds excess moisture. Annual repotting also lets you inspect root health and bump up a pot size if needed.

Quick-Reference Guide: Matching Mix to Orchid

Start with the genus name on your orchid’s tag, then match it to the recipe above. Epiphytic orchids (Phalaenopsis, Cattleya, Dendrobium, Oncidium) need bark-heavy blends with a clear wet-dry cycle. Terrestrial orchids (Paphiopedilum, Phragmipedium, jewel orchids) need moisture-retentive mixes with pumice or peatmoss. Adjust particle size to root thickness — thin roots get ¼-inch particles, thick roots get ¾-inch. If the orchid came in a store-bought bark bag and grew well for a year, that recipe is a fine starting point; just add perlite and charcoal to improve its drainage and longevity. If it struggled, switch to the genus-specific recipe above.

FAQs

Can I use regular potting soil for orchids?

Standard garden soil or houseplant potting soil is too dense for orchid roots. It lacks the large air pockets epiphytic orchids need and stays wet too long, which causes root rot in a matter of weeks. Bark-based, soil-free mixes are required for healthy root respiration.

How often should I repot an orchid into fresh mix?

Once every 12 months is the standard interval, because bark breaks down and loses its structure over time. Decomposed bark holds too much water and compacts around the roots. Annual repotting with fresh mix restores drainage and gives you a chance to trim dead roots.

Does sphagnum moss work better than bark for orchids?

It depends on the orchid and the pot size. Sphagnum moss holds more moisture than bark, so it works well for miniature Phalaenopsis in 2-inch pots and for moisture-loving terrestrials. In larger pots or for orchids that need a dry cycle, pure moss stays wet too long. Many growers mix 10–15% moss into a bark base for the best balance.

What does charcoal do in an orchid potting mix?

Horticultural charcoal absorbs impurities and excess minerals from water and fertilizer, and its porous structure creates air pockets. It also resists decomposition, so it helps keep the mix open and functional longer than bark alone. Use 10% of the total volume.

Can I reuse old orchid potting mix for a new plant?

Reusing old mix is not recommended because bark breaks down and compresses within a year, losing drainage. Old mix may also harbor bacteria, fungi, or mineral salt buildup from fertilizer. Fresh mix is inexpensive insurance against disease and poor root health.
